FTP中使用SOCKS5代理问题:通过代理下载文件不完全???
FTP中使用SOCKS5代理问题:通过代理下载文件不完全???
我在本机安装了一个wingate作为代理,用PASV模式下载
我的做法如下:
1、用CONNECT方式连接代理的1080端口。并连通(该连接作为控制连接)
2、在以上建立的连接 发送FTP控制命令
3、当发送了PASV命令后,再建立一个CONNECT连接代理的1080端口(该连接作为数据连接)
4、发送RETR命令。
5、在数据连接上接受数据。
现在我遇到的问题是用ftp下载文件不完全,只下载了一部分,我查看了代理,代理收到的数据也不完全,问题出在代理只收到部分数据。。
高手请赐教啊 。。。。